Output 7d23c63b18c265da3610a9ffd924f311055be0e1ecb22295ea989f0b77c1273a:0

value
124853685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79e3802757ee61656de54ad0a4a74e6b47ee0fd7 OP_EQUAL
address
3CoWDmrCLGEccgahW5BoCXyJeZ1sFqQxVz
transaction
7d23c63b18c265da3610a9ffd924f311055be0e1ecb22295ea989f0b77c1273a
spent
true